About this panjika

  • Computed with the old Surya Siddhanta arithmetic that traditional Bengali almanacs still use: sidereal positions, sankranti-based months of 29 to 32 days, and tithi measured from the almanac sunrise.
  • The Bangla Academy calendar used for official dates in Bangladesh fixes month lengths by rule, so its date and the traditional date differ by a day or two through the year.
  • Sunrise, sunset and every window are shown in Bangladesh Standard Time.
